Kuka unveils new compact autonomous mobile robot for intralogistics

February 6, 2023 by David Edwards Leave a Comment

Kuka has expanded its portfolio of mobile platforms with the unveiling of a new autonomous mobile robot for intralogistics.

Describing it as a “compact powerhouse meets the highest safety requirements”, Kuka says the new generation of the KMP 600-S diffDrive is “fast – up to two meters per second – and equally safe, thanks to laser scanners and 3D object detection”.

Mobile solutions must meet extremely high standards for industrial use, says the company. The Kuka KMP 600-S diffDrive mobile platform provides a new automated guided vehicle system with high-speed support for production intralogistics and a payload of up to 600 kg. Baidu aims to create ‘world’s largest fully driverless ride-hailing area’

December 28, 2022 by Mai Tao Leave a Comment

Baidu, an AI company with strong internet foundation and often referred to as China’s equivalent of Google, has embarked on a major expansion of its commercialized fully driverless robotaxi service in Wuhan.

The new expansion would triple the size of its current operation area, increasing the number of robotaxis in service and expanding operating time to include key evening hours.

The move marks a major milestone on Baidu’s ambitious autonomous ride-hailing roadmap, as the company plans to put an additional 200 fully driverless robotaxis into operation across China in 2023, aiming to cover “the largest fully driverless ride-hailing service area in the world” by the end of the year. ABB launches new, ‘fastest’ five-axis Delta robot

July 28, 2022 by David Edwards Leave a Comment

ABB has launched a new five-axis Delta robot which it claims is “the fastest for lightweight product picking, packing and reorientation”.

The new machine is part of the FlexPicker Delta robot portfolio and is called the IRB 365. With five axis and 1.5 kg payload, the IRB 365 is both flexible and the fastest in its class for reorienting packaged lightweight products such as cookies, chocolates, peppers, candies, small bottles, and parcels.

Responding to the rise in e-commerce and growing demand for shelf ready packaged goods, the IRB 365 has been developed for applications including food and beverage, pharmaceuticals and consumer goods, where production line speed and adaptability are essential. Kodiak Robotics and US Xpress to pilot new autonomous truck route

April 16, 2022 by David Edwards Leave a Comment

Kodiak Robotics, a developer of self-driving trucks, has teamed up with US Xpress, one of America’s largest carrier fleets, to launch Level 4 autonomous freight service between Dallas-Fort Worth and Atlanta using Kodiak’s self-driving trucks.

US Xpress will become the first cornerstone truckload partner in Kodiak’s Partner Deployment Program, working hand-in-hand with Kodiak to deploy self-driving technology.

This strategic partnership also marks the launch of the first commercial autonomous trucking lane to the East Coast. [Read more…] about Kodiak Robotics and US Xpress to pilot new autonomous truck route

TinyMobileRobots celebrates marking 1 millionth sports field

March 25, 2022 by David Edwards Leave a Comment

Denmark-based TinyMobileRobots, a provider of fully autonomous GPS line-marking robots, has officially marked its 1 millionth sports field, culminating in “savings of approximately 1.6 million hours, $102.5 million and 1.5 million gallons of paint” for its rapidly growing customer base across three continents.

The landmark moment occurred in Dallas, Texas with FC Dallas, who manages 20 soccer fields. They have been using TinyMobileRobots’ solution for four years.

TinyMobileRobots can autonomously mark lines for virtually every type of sports field, including soccer, American football, baseball, lacrosse, softball and more. [Read more…] about TinyMobileRobots celebrates marking 1 millionth sports field

Interview: Formic aims to change the way you integrate robotics and automation into your facility

January 31, 2022 by Mark Allinson Leave a Comment

Formic Technologies is a new type of company which, itself, is the result of the huge changes that are occurring in the robotics and automation market, what with all sorts of new robots and technologies emerging, none of which is cheap to buy, and creating an increasing amount of complexity when it comes to implementing them in an integrated system at, say, a factory. 

In simple terms, you can hire robots – for example, Universal Robots collaborative robots – and other automation technologies from Formic. But it’s more than that. You can also have Formic design the implementation, and handle the integration, for which the startup company has many established partners.

And possibly Formic’s unique selling point is its promise to link its income from its customers to those customers’ success with the automation systems Formic installs. In other words, it’s a kind of like a robotics-as-a-service company which you can pay as you go according to a sliding scale – or “Easy to start, easy to scale”, as Formic likes to put it.
